Maxine Schwamb's Obituary
Maxine Ida Schwamb, (nee Oechsner), went to be with her Lord and Savior on January 7, 2006, at the age of 80, after suffering from heart failure. She was surrounded by her family. Maxine was born March 9, 1925, and she and her husband, Franklin, raised their family in West Bend, WI. Maxine formerly was employed at Amity Leather and B.C. Ziegler, both in West Bend. In 1988, they moved to Waupaca, WI after retirement She will be remembered as having a humble, loving, compassionate, and generous spirit. She enjoyed camping and nature, especially birds. She was an avid reader and card player. She also enjoyed volunteering. Maxine loved the Lord and started each day in His Word.
